### Catalogue imports in Bramblewick

When a partner library submits a catalogue file, the Bramblewick importer validates each record against the shelf-location schema before committing. Rejected records are queued for manual review, not dropped — reassure callers that nothing is lost. Imports can take up to four hours for large files. Status codes, retry steps, and escalation criteria are documented on the internal page here.

wiki page, tahaf-tajog: https://jira.ordindyn.corp/pipeline

## Configuration

LedgerLens loads plugin config from `.env` at startup. Plugins get read-only access to the audit stream; scopes are declared in your manifest. Required vars: `LENS_PORT`, `LENS_RETENTION_DAYS`, `LENS_PLUGIN_DIR`. Retention below 30 days is rejected. Hot reload is off by default; enable with `LENS_RELOAD=1`. Plugins authenticating against the core viewer need a signing credential in the same file. Place that credential on the line directly after this sentence.

sealed setting: LEDGER_TOKEN5=b395a

Runbook — Fenholt Office Move, Leg 3

Driver departs the old Fenholt site 07:00 sharp. Load order: archive crates first, then IT pallets, server cage last. No stacking on the cage. Route via the north bypass; loading dock at Ashcombe opens 08:30. Driver signs the manifest at both ends. Coordinator confirms arrival by radio. The confidential courier hand-over instruction is given below.

handover note for yagef-bagep: the drudor pelius courier leaves the kasdor zorvan norir ledger at gate 8016 under passcode 755406

Ticket: Baseline vault locked — Graphite-Lint

The vault storing the static-analysis baseline file for Graphite-Lint auto-locked after three failed fetch attempts during last night's CI run. Without the baseline, every scan reports thousands of pre-existing findings as new. Future maintainers: do not regenerate the baseline; unlock the vault instead and restore the original file. Unlocking requires the recovery passphrase recorded below.

vault phrase of tajop-haduf = holath-brivan-wenax